Dear Student,
In view of some of the posts by some of our students, it has become necessary to provide some basic information especially on the indefinite closure of the University of Ibadan in order to prevent any confusion. I therefore wish to state categorically that students on ODL mode are in no way affected by the closure and that, 
1. The UIDLC model is ICT enabled student support blended learning with on line and face-to-face interactive components which entails students self-studying ahead of Interactive session. 
2. For Returning students therfore (as indicated in the Calendar for 2015/16),  you are expected to be registering for your courses depending on the status of their results and commence self - study of  course materials before the commencement of interactive sessions and continuous assessments. This which ends early in June is what you should engage in now. So, this is not supposed to be a free period. You can perform better that approaching your study differently. Do not wait till the commencement of Interactive session before studying.
3. It is important to advise that, even students who are yet to register ashould avail themselves the relevant course materials and not wait till after registration or commencement of interactive sessions before studying the relevant materials. There is a big difference between  a student who studies his/her course materials before interactive session and others. 
4. Immediately after the end of registration, validly registered students will be invited to join online interactive classes in the courses they registered for. Please note that online interaction and academic support have proved helpful to many who care to take advantage of the platforms.
5. Please note that there are many very active dedicated  social media platforms and pages that have been or will be created by some of you or your facilitators that can be of immense academic support and assist you in your programme. You are advised to join these depending on your circumstance. We will soon publish details of these to ease your membership. 

Having addressed the real issue, please permit me to add that, we are making frantic efforts to publish all outstanding results so all students can conveniently register and to avoid problems relating to students inability to register as appropriate. We regret and apologise for the hardships caused to the affected students. 
The other issue relates to results of Final year students. The results could not be concluded as at date because students in Faculty of Education are yet to conclude their Teaching Practice/ Practicum and more importantly, the deadline for submission of project is next month. Results cannot possibly be computed without the projects.

I seek continued understanding and further cooperation from all. Things are getting better and can still be improved upon with the cooperation of all.

CALENDAR AND IMPORTANT INFORMATION FOR FRESH STUDENTS 2015/2016 SESSION PLEASE READ CAREFULLY Dear Student, Please find attached Calendar and other important information for the commencement of your study which is also pasted below. Also attached are: 1. Procedure for the payment of Acceptance Fee 2. Procedure for the payment of School Fee 3. How to login and register your courses 4. Guidelines for registration of courses (which was sent to you earlier) You will receive another message from the computer proficiency unit for you to improve your computer proficiency skill. It is important to let you know that before the interactive session you ought to have read and familiarise your self with the course materials in courses you registered for so as to make for easy comprehension during the face to face interaction. Apart from face to face interaction, you will have the opportunity for real time online interactive session that will be handled by dedicated Academic Advisors. This will start on 6th of June which is before orientation, however only duly registered students will benefit while others will be included as soon as they register. For help and further information, please contact by phone: (08159694091, 08159694092 between 9 and 4pm Monday -Friday) and 08077593553, 08077593555(mobile) or by email: ssu@dlc.ui.edu.ng. No complaints will be officially responded to except the ones sent to the Student Support Unit via ssu@dlc.ui.edu.ng. IMPORTANT INFORMATION AND ACADEMIC CALENDAR FOR FRESH STUDENTS 2015/2016 SESSION 100 & 200 LEVEL NEWLY ADMITTED STUDENTS (Including Fast Track) Registration Commencement of Registration (1 & 2 stream) - Started since Monday, April 18, 2016 Commencement of Registration (3 & 4 stream) - Started since Friday, May 13, 2016 Downloading of Course Materials - Immediately after Registration Closing date for registration - Saturday, June 11, 2016 (Student will be assisted with their registration during the Matriculation and Orientation ceremonies and by phone through the following help lines: (08159694091, 08159694092 between 9am and 4pm Monday - Friday) and 08077593553,08077593555(mobile) or by email: ssu@dlc.ui.edu.ng. Matriculation & Orientation holds between 14 June & 16 June, 2016 at the International Conference Centre and the Computer Based Testing Complex, Sasa, Distance Learning Centre, University of Ibadan . First Semester First Semester Self Study/Online Interaction - 13 May – 17 June, 2016 First Semester Interactive Session - 18 June – 24 July, 2016 First Semester Revision - 25 July – 31 July, 2016 First Semester Continuous Assessment - 4 July – 31 July, 2016 First Semester Examination - 1 August – 28 August, 2016 Mid-Session Break (2 weeks) - 29 August – 11 September, 2016 Teaching Observation holds between - 12 September – 28 October, 2016 (for affected Education Students only) Second Semester Second Semester Self Study - 12 September – 28 October, 2016 Second Semester Interactive Session - 29 October – 27 November, 2016 Second Semester Revision - 28 November – 4 December, 2016 Second Semester CAs Administration - 7 November – 7 December, 2016 Second Semester Examination - 8 December, 2016 – 22January, 2017 (Excluding Christmas & New year holidays) EXPLANATORY NOTES (It is very important that you register promptly to assist in keeping to the Calendar) 1. Download of Course Materials: You are expected to download and commence study of the course material immediately after registration. This is very important for you to be in good standing before commencement of interactive session and administration of CAs. 2. You are expected to attend interactive sessions in courses which you registered for as indicated on the Time Table that will be sent to you ahead of interactive session. 3. Add and Delete: After registration and the interactive sessions, you will be given the opportunity to ADD and DELETE courses based on your choice but note that Compulsory and Required courses cannot be so deleted. This will be available online on the student’s portal. Information on this will be provided after close of registration. 4. Computer Proficiency Skill: Please note that you are expected to develop your computer skill in relevant technologies to ease your study. The Centre offers computer training and certification and students are encouraged to take advantage of this opportunity. Details on this including procedure will be sent to you in a different mail. 5. For help and further information, please contact by phone: (08159694091, 08159694092 between 9am and 4pmMonday - Friday) and 08077593553, 08077593555(mobile) or by email: ssu@dlc.ui.edu.ng. No complaints will be officially responded to except the ones sent to the Student Support Unit via ssu@dlc.ui.edu.ng. 6. Students are to note that the dedicated student email address is the only authorized email that will receive attention from the Centre. Students are, therefore, advised to always check their dedicated emails for correspondence sent from the school from time to time. DLC MANAGEMENT 23 May,

UNIVERSITY OF IBADAN DISTANCE LEARNING CENTRE 2015/2016 MATRICULATION CEREMONY NOTICE TO STUDENTS COLLECTION AND RETURNING OF ACADEMIC GOWN, SIGNING OF MATRICULATION OATH AND REGISTER The attention of all DLC Matriculating students is hereby drawn to the following information: 1. The Matriculation Ceremony for the 2015/2016 (fresh undergraduates) will take place on Tuesday, 14 June, 2016 at 10.00am Venue: The International Conference Centre, University of Ibadan (UI Second Gate) All Matriculants must present themselves for the Ceremony, neatly dressed and seated in the Hall not later than 9.30am. Please you are enjoined to exhibit an orderly conduct throughout the duration of the Ceremony. 1. Collection of Academic Gowns and Caps will take place at any of the following Centres: - DLC Computer-Based Testing (CBT) Centre, Distance Learning Complex, University of Ibadan, Ajibode - Extension, Sasa Road, Ibadan. - DLC Bodija Office, 20, Awolowo Road, Old Bodija, Ibadan. 1. Process of Collection and Returning of the Academic Gown: Academic gowns will be available for collection at the location indicated above as from Wednesday, 08 to 13 June, 2016 between 10am - 3pm. Please follow this process: 1. Take your school receipt to the Collection Officers who will write your name and sign at the back of your receipt. 2. Collect your academic gown and cap from him/ her. 3. Return the gown and cap at the venue immediately after the matriculation ceremony. OR latest within a week after matriculation at the Computer-Based Testing (CBT) Centre, Distance Learning Complex, University of Ibadan, Ajibode Extension, Sasa Road, Ibadan. ***You are to note that if the academic gown is not returned a week after matriculation, it will attract a sum of N5,000.00 every week as penalty. If you lose the gown or deface it, you will pay a fine of N10,000.00 1. Signing of Matriculation Oath: All matriculating students are expected to take a solemn oath during Matriculation (copies of the oath will be included in the package to the students). Students are only required to fill the oath form and drop it in the boxes provided at the venue. DLC will be responsible for taking the form to the Commissioner of Oath for signing. Students MUST not patronize outsiders for this purpose. 1. Signing of Matriculation Register: Signing of Matriculation Register is compulsory. All students who have paid their school fees and have matriculation numbers are expected to sign Matriculation Register. The Register will be available at the matriculation ground and DLC Office. Kindly ensure that you sign it to authenticate your admission after the Ceremony. 1. Orientation Programme: Orientation programme takes place on Wednesday, 15 June, 2016 at the same venue for Matriculation Ceremony (i.e. International Conference Centre, UI) and Thursday, 16 June, 2016 at the Computer-Based Testing (CBT) Centre, Distance Learning Complex, University of Ibadan, Ajibode Extension, Sasa Road, Ibadan starting from 9am each day. Students are expected to be seated in the Hall not later than 8.45am. 1. Internet Service: Students will be provided with free internet access during the Interactive Session for those who may wish to access their mobile/computer devices at the venue of the Orientation programme. 1. Course Registration Support: Assistance will be given to students having problems with their course registration during the Matriculation and Orientation programme. Kindly come with your laptops or other devices. Details will be provided. 1. Commencement of Online Interactive Session: Please note that the online interactive session starts on Tuesday, 7 June, 2016. Kindly check your personal and official DLC mail accounts. This is in addition to the face-to-face interaction that commences on 18 June, 2016. 1. Collection of ID Card: ID Cards are ready for collection even at the venue. PLEASE NOTE THAT ORIENTATION PROGRAMME WILL BE HELD AS SCHEDULED ON WEDNESDAY, 15 AND THURSDAY, 16 JUNE, 2016 Signed Deputy Registrar

Dear Student,

Please find below and embedded (attached) a very important information on your programme. Please read carefully.


This is a quick one to give an update on your programme. It is important for you to advise your friends or mates who have been indifferent to messages in respect of their programmes. This is important because of lack of understanding on procedure and processes as evidenced in the social media pertaining to their studies.  It is also important to ask that you configure your mobile phones to receive appropriate messages from the Centre. Please note the following vital information:

1.       Extension of Registration and administration of CA:  As a result of a meeting with a cross section of students, the deadline for registration is now 31 July, 2016 with the commitment that there will be no further extension whatever may be the case. This will definitely affect the commencement of the Continuous Assessment (CA) for 300 -500 level students which will now start from August 1, 2016.The CA for Fresh students and students having ‘carry – over’ in 100 and 200 level courses are going to start their CA on 22 July, 2016. The practice sessions on the CA platform will commence on Friday, 15 June, 2016.

2.       Interactive Session for 400 and 500 level students at the Lagos Centre: Obviously, the 3-daySallah holiday requires the re-scheduling of some of the classes during the holiday period. In view of these, the Centre is rescheduling the missed sessions. Affected students will be contacted on the new schedule.

3.       Extra- units: Some students have requested for extra-units for different reasons but it should be noted that extra-units is not an entitlement and can only be granted in certain situations within prescribed limit. In view of the situation with some of our students, there is compelling need to allow some FINAL YEAR STUDENTS to exceed approved limits. Consequently, the Board of Examiners of the Centre has decided that final year students should be allowed to register not more than 10 units in addition to the current registration.’

4.       Change of course/Department: there have been many complaints of delay in effecting requests relating to change from one Department to the other. It has to be noted that this is not automatic and there is the need for background check on entry qualifications of applicants.

5.       Add and Delete: There will be opportunity to add and delete after the close of registration.

6.       Submission of Final Year projects: Final year students are advised to submit their projects so that their results can be computed ahead of graduation in November. It is important that the soft copy of the projects be sent to designated email account for each department apart from the hard/bound copies and CD to the Department.

7.       Complaints: Let me assure you that the complaints on varying issues are being addressed. However, it is important for individuals to take responsibility for their study by availing themselves with readily available information. While some complaints are genuine, there are many that were due to lack of information. Some students who suspended their studies will need help to re-activate more so if they never suspended their study officially. 

8.       Sale of hard copies of course materials: This is to inform you that, hard copies of some recently updated course materials that are consistent with ODL format are available for sale at reasonable prices. Copies will be available at both Ibadan and Lagos Centres from Monday, 18 July, 2016.

9.       Calendar:  It is important to reiterate our commitment to the Calendar as published. The adjustments with be minimal. However, your cooperation and cooperation will be appreciated.

10.   Student Handbook: The latest and current version of Student Handbook will be uploaded on Monday, 18 July, 2014. Please, read about all you need to know about DLC and its operations.

2016/2017 ADMISSIONS EXERCISE

UNIVERSITY OF IBADAN, IBADAN.

2016/2017 ADMISSIONS EXERCISE

PRE-ADMISSION SCREENING OF CANDIDATES

1. The University of Ibadan, Ibadan, hereby requests all candidates who made the University their most preferred Institution of choice and scored 200 or above in the 2016 UTME to submit their bio-data and WAEC/NECO SSCE O’L Results ONLINE through http://www.admissions.ui.edu.ng from Monday, 05 September to Friday, 23 September, 2016. A scanned copy of the result should also be uploaded.

2. Candidates should note that any results not released before 23 September, 2016 will not be considered for the 2016/2017 Admissions Exercise.

3. Instructions:-

(i) Candidates should ensure that the on-line forms are carefully filled, following ALL necessary instructions, as "mistake(s)" may lead to disqualification.

(ii) Candidates can return to the portal, up till 23 September 2016 to edit/complete their previous entries or otherwise review and print their submissions. Please ensure that you click "FINAL SUBMISSION" before printing. Candidates should note that no further editing CAN be done after final submissions.

(iii) Candidates are advised to use functional e-mail addresses and telephone numbers to enable the University reach them in the course of the Admission exercise or whenever the need arises.

(iv) Candidates are expected to upload their passport photographs and signatures. The image format for the passport and signature is JPEG and must not exceed the specification. The photographs must be on white background without glasses, cap or headgear.

(v) An online help desk platform on http://www.admissions.ui.edu.ng/helpdesk will be available to handle all genuine enquiries.

4. Candidates should please note that it is only when an 'O' level result is deficient for a course of choice that another result may be presented to complement. Candidates presenting two 'O' level results (6 credits at 2 Sittings) should ensure that the comprehensive details of both results are submitted. PLEASE NOTE THAT THE COLLEGE OF MEDICINE AND FACULTY OF PHARMACY ACCEPT 5 CREDITS AT 1 SITTING ONLY.

5. The deadline for submission of bio-data / 'O' level results may not be extended. Any candidate whose data is not submitted within the stipulated time may not be considered for the Pre-Admission Screening exercise and for admission.

6. Misrepresentation/falsification of documents is a serious offence. Candidates are therefore advised to submit genuine documents only. Anyone found guilty of this offence will be disqualified automatically and in appropriate cases, be handed over to the Law Enforcement Agencies.

7. Candidates are requested to note that payment of the Admission Portal Access Fee of N2, 500.00 is for processing of each candidate’s application. This does not guarantee admission.

8. Candidates are strongly advised to adhere strictly to the guidelines stipulated above for successful completion of the online submissions.

Signed

Olujimi I. Olukoya, MNIM, FPA

Registrar

APPLICATION FOR ADMISSION 2016/17

Applications are hereby invited from qualified candidates for admission into the under-listed Undergraduate Degree Programmes in the Distance Learning Centre, University of Ibadan, under the Centre’s new Open and Distance Learning (ODL) Platform for the 2016/17 Academic Session. The under-listed are the available Courses and their duration:

FACULTY OF ARTS

1. B.A. English (4 & 5 Sessions)

2. B.A. Philosophy and Public Affairs (4 & 5 Sessions)

FACULTY OF THE SOCIAL SCIENCES

1. B.Sc. Psychology (4 & 5 Sessions)

2. B.Sc. Economics (4 & 5 Sessions)

3. B.Sc. Political Science (4 & 5 Sessions)

FACULTY OF EDUCATION

1. Bachelor of Social Work (4 & 5 Sessions)

ADMISSION REQUIREMENTS

FACULTY OF ARTS

Entry Requirements for Ordinary Level Applicants – 100 Level (5 Sessions)

5 O/L Credits at ONE sitting or 6 O/L Credits at TWO sittings -including English Language, Literature in English, an Arts subject and any other 2 or 3 subjects. Department of English REQUIRES Literature in English.

For Direct Entry (4 Years)

Candidates with at least 2 A-Level papers, NCE or equivalent plus 5 O/L Credits at ONE sitting or 6 O/L Credits at TWO sittings including English Language, Literature in English (for the Department of English) and ANY other combination of Arts subjects are eligible for admission into the four 4-Session Programme. Mature candidates with relevant Diplomas and the Nigeria Certificate in Education (NCE) in any discipline are qualified to apply for the 4-year Direct Entry Programme in B.A. Philosophy and Public Affairs. Department of English requires a Pass in English Literature at A/L GCE, or at the Principal Level in HSC Examination or at least a Merit in NCE and one other Arts subject.

FACULTY OF THE SOCIAL SCIENCES

Entry Requirements for Ordinary Level Applicants – 100 Level (5 Sessions)

Department of Psychology

5 Ordinary Level Credits at ONE sitting or 6 O/L Credits at TWO sittings including English Language and a Pass in Mathematics and ANY one subject from the Social Sciences including Biology.

Department of Economics

Candidates must have 5 Credits at ONE sitting or 6 Credits at TWO sittings which should include Mathematics, Economics and English Language and any TWO of Arts or Social Science subjects.

Department of Political Science

Candidates must have 5 Credits at ONE sitting or 6 Credits at TWO sittings which should include Government or History, English Language and ANY other 3 subjects plus at least a Pass in Mathematics.

Entry Requirements For Direct Entry (4 Sessions)

Department of Psychology

Candidates must possess 2 A/L Passes including Government or History plus 5 O/L Credits at ONE sitting or 6 O/L Credits at TWO sittings including English Language plus a Pass in Mathematics AND any ONE subject from the Social Sciences.
NCE: NOT lower than a Credit Pass.
HND: NOT lower than a Credit Pass from any discipline.
NURSING: Registered with Nigerian Nursing and Midwifery Council (RNM).

B.Sc: NOT lower than a 3rd Class from ANY discipline.

Department of Economics

· Candidates must have 2 A/L Passes or its equivalent but O/L Credits SHOULD include Mathematics and Economics.

· In addition to the above requirements, holders of HND/ND/OND/NCE/Diploma Certificates in the Faculties of the Social Sciences, Science and Education of accredited and recognised tertiary institutions can be admitted without prejudice to prescribed O/L requirements.

· Holders of Bachelor's Degrees from Arts, Education, and Social Sciences may be admitted without prejudice to prescribed O/L requirements.

Department of Political Science

· Candidate must have any 2 A/L Passes plus 5 Credits at O’Level in WASSCE/GCE/NECO including English Language and Government/History and ANY other subject from Social Sciences or Arts at ONE sitting or 6 Credits at TWO sittings (with at least a Pass in Mathematics).

· In addition to the above requirements, holders of (a) Higher National Diploma (HND) (b) Ordinary National Diploma (OND) (c) Nigeria Certificate in Education (NCE) and (d) Diploma Certificates in the Faculties of the Social Sciences, Sciences, Arts and Education of accredited and recognized institutions of higher learning can be admitted without prejudice to prescribed O/L requirements.

· Holders of Bachelor’s degrees from Arts, Education and Social Sciences may be admitted without prejudice to prescribed O/L requirements.

FACULTY OF EDUCATION

Entry Requirements for Ordinary Level Applicants – 100 Level (5 Sessions)

Departments of Social Work

Candidates must have 5 Credits at O/L including English Language at ONE sitting or SIX Credits at TWO sittings in SSCE /WAEC /NECO.

For Direct Entry (4 Sessions)

Department of Social Work (4 Sessions)

Holders of Diploma or OND in Social Work: NCE, General or Mental Health, Nursing Certificates, (R.N., RM etc) Diploma in Adult Education and Community Development, Diploma in Cooperative Studies or Diploma in Industrial and Trade Unionism from Institutions recognized by the University of Ibadan for the 4-year programme. In addition, candidates must also have at least five Credits in GCE O/L /SSCE/NECO, including English Language at ONE sitting or SIX Credits at TWO sittings. Holders of first degree from the University of Ibadan and any recognized University who are interested in BSW may also apply.

Teaching Subjects:

The following Teaching Subjects are available for candidates under Faculty of Education:

Political Science (Government or History), Christian Religious Studies, Yoruba, English (Literature in English), Geography. Please, ensure you have a requisite O’Level in respect of any of the subjects.

IMPORTANT NOTICE ON ADMISSION REQUIREMENTS

1. Maturity Criteria (for 5-Year Programmes Only) Candidates who do not possess the above qualifications may apply on the grounds of maturity/work experience. Such candidates must be at least 26 years old and must provide the following information: academic qualification(s), professional experience, self appraisal of professional competence and recommendations from competent individuals. An oral interview and a literacy test would be part of their selection process. Further details will be provided to applicants.

2. Fast Track (only in the Faculty of The Social Sciences) Candidates with HND, Bachelor and Higher Degrees can be considered for a fast track programme in the Faculty of The Social Sciences. A fast track student will be able to conclude his/her programme a session earlier than the normal duration. The implication of this is that, this category of students will have to offer more courses to enable them fulfill the requirements for graduation during the period.

ENTRANCE EXAMINATION

Entrance Examination (For Candidates with O/L Qualifications ONLY) Applicants are required to take an Aptitude, Communicative and IT Competence Test as part of the admission process. The test would incorporate elements of computer literacy, familiarity with DLC Portal/Website (http:///SS4fc), basic knowledge of the Open Distance Learning mode and general knowledge.
